Output 2bdcd8555b89f64b655e1a7cbdfea7debfbc41e3eec977a044d4bf152acfb29a:1

value
612401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a62acaf90c16ff597b5b0c24113be196dd75a85a OP_EQUAL
address
3GqdMgr6rfZDUmaGYnX7QCT3YmyQ3Sj9Xt
transaction
2bdcd8555b89f64b655e1a7cbdfea7debfbc41e3eec977a044d4bf152acfb29a
confirmations
278776
spent
true